Accident summary

On Monday 9 June 1986 at 08:45 a slight collision occurred near A761 involving 2 vehicles (bus or coach (17 or more pass seats)) and 1 casualty (1 slight) Weather at the time was recorded as raining + high winds. Road surface conditions were wet or damp. Lighting was described as daylight.
